A mesothelioma-related settlement is an agreement reached between the victim or their family members and the companies that are responsible for their asbestos exposure. Compensation can be used to pay for medical expenses, lost income and more.
A top law firm will examine thoroughly and pinpoint all asbestos companies that are accountable. This includes reviewing medical records, employment histories, and other research.
Amounts
While no amount of compensation can compensate for a mesothelioma-related diagnosis, it can assist patients and their families deal with the financial burdens of the disease. Compensation can pay for medical expenses along with lost wages and other costs associated with the disease. It may also cover the victim's emotional distress as well as pain and suffering. The exact amount of mesothelioma compensation depends on many factors. The nature of the asbestos exposure that each victim has experienced will affect the settlement amount. A law firm that focuses on mesothelioma must review the mesothelioma exposure history of each victim to determine when and in which location exposure occurred. The extent of the cancer, the age at which it was diagnosed and whether or not the victim died as a result of their illness can affect the final settlement amount.
Most mesothelioma claims settle through settlement agreements. Settlements are preferred over a trial because they require less time to resolve and are generally lower in cost than an award from a jury. A mesothelioma lawyer can help the family members of victims decide which option is right for them.
Mesothelioma lawyers can negotiate large settlements with mesothelioma manufacturers on behalf of the victims and their families. They have a long-standing track record in this field and can assist with multiple claims against different defendants. They are also aware of how to swiftly get compensation and the best methods of settling a case.
Trust funds are used to compensate those who have suffered asbestos-related injuries as a result of the negligence of bankrupt companies. Trust funds usually pay victims up to six figures and even millions. Mesothelioma lawsuits are more costly than settling a case via a trust fund, but they are longer-lasting and pose the possibility of not getting any money at all.
A mesothelioma compensation settlement is tax-free. However, the money received could be subject to other taxes, both federal and state-based. A mesothelioma litigation lawyer will help clients be aware of the tax implications of their settlements. They can also assist clients in completing any required tax forms. An attorney for mesothelioma claimants can also bring a wrongful death lawsuit on behalf of a loved one.
Timeframes
Mesothelioma, a serious and complex asbestos-related disease, is a very serious and complex illness. Medical expenses, lost income and other expenses can be overwhelming for patients and their families. Compensation from a mesothelioma settlement or lawsuit can help families ease their burdens and help manage the costs.
Many victims choose to settle their cases instead of go through a trial. Settlements offer a faster resolution and reduces the time required to get payments. Additionally, the costs involved in making a case for trial can be costly. A mesothelioma settlement can also save estates of victims money on court costs and attorney fees.
In general, mesothelioma compensation can be received in one year or less. However, some patients might have to wait longer than this in the event of filing multiple claims against different asbestos manufacturers. Anyone diagnosed with mesothelioma could also be eligible for compensation earlier when a trust fund has been established by the asbestos manufacturer.
Asbestos lawyers can assist clients identify the best source of their mesothelioma compensation. They can also assist patients find potential sources of exposure. This can be difficult for some because of the long time of latency for the disease. Mesothelioma lawyers also know the emotional, physical and psychological stress that patients and their families have to endure due to the illness. It is therefore important that victims find experienced mesothelioma attorneys.
An attorney for mesothelioma can assist their client in submitting an application for Veterans Benefits and Social Security Disability during the settlement process. They can also assist their client in filing an appeal if the claim is denied.
A small percentage of mesothelioma cases will be tried in the court. It can take up to an entire year or more for a case to reach a verdict in the event that a lawsuit is contested. However, a mesothelioma victim who is a senior or terminally ill might be capable of speeding up the lawsuit timeline by filing a motion to grant preference with their lawyer. They'll need supporting medical documentation in this type of case.
Legal Questions
Mesothelioma lawsuits are complicated, and the legal issues involved can be complex. An attorney who has experience in asbestos-related diseases mesothelioma, litigation and mesothelioma can help clients navigate the legal process.
Legal proceedings can be lengthy, and the exact settlement figure is not always available until an agreement on a final settlement has been reached. The number of defendants, and their financial resources, can influence the amount of compensation that a plaintiff is entitled to. Defendants may be able to pay more if they have insurance coverage.
Mesothelioma patients are usually entitled to compensation damages that include medical expenses and wages lost. Also, they may receive punitive damage intended to penalize the defendant for committing a crime and deter others from engaging in similar behaviour.
Asbestos patients can sue mesothelioma victims against the companies who exposed them. They are eligible for compensation, regardless of whether the business is bankrupt or not. Mesothelioma victims who are eligible to receive a settlement aren't required to go to trial, and the majority of cases come to an agreement through mediation.
If the defendant refuses to settle, then the case will go to trial. A jury will determine how much the plaintiff should be awarded based upon evidence and testimony presented by the plaintiff's mesothelioma lawyers.
Jurors will also take into consideration the victim's pain and suffering. They will also consider the victim's suffering and pain. The jury can give punitive damages, which are meant to punish the defendant and discourage others from engaging in similar behaviour.
Recently however, a huge number of patients with mesothelioma have been able to claim compensation from trust funds set by asbestos-related companies which were bankrupt. They do not need to file a mesothelioma suit to receive these funds and the process generally takes a couple of weeks or months to complete.
The most experienced mesothelioma lawyers will negotiate the most favorable settlement terms for their clients. They are also prepared to go to trial if necessary to protect the rights of their clients. Costs
A mesothelioma lawsuit will be able to cover future and present medical expenses. These costs can be quite high for victims and their families. Compensation can include compensation for lost wages, suffering, pain and other damages. A mesothelioma lawyer will help you determine the value of your claim.
The majority of mesothelioma legal lawsuits settle outside of court. Asbestos lawyers can bargain with trust funds as well as companies that are liable to settle for the best possible payout for their clients. Many asbestos victims receive multi-million dollar settlements and jury awards.
In some cases, victims of mesothelioma are qualified for a financial aid package that is offered by the US Department of Veterans Affairs. The Department of Veteran Affairs offers financial aid to patients who were exposed to asbestos while in the military. Veterans comprise 30 percent of mesothelioma patients.
Compensation is available through a settlement agreement for wrongful death. Lawyers for mesothelioma must demonstrate that not only that their client was exposed to asbestos but that this exposure caused the cancer. The lawyer also has to prove how the diagnosis affected the life of the victim.
It is important to note that the statutes of limitation are time-bound and victims may miss the chance to bring a lawsuit if they wait too long. It is therefore important to hire a mesothelioma lawyer early as you can.
When the firm accepts a case, the team will use databases and other resources in order to determine where and when the victim had been exposed to asbestos. This will inform the trust fund or asbestos company to file a complaint against. Most cases are resolved when an agreement has been reached between the mesothelioma trust fund and the legal team.
Certain cases, however, need to be heard in court to determine an outcome. A mesothelioma lawyer can determine whether it is the best option for the victim or if the case should be tried.
It is important to know that even a substantial mesothelioma settlement cannot make up for the illness of the victim or the loss of loved ones. However it can provide the financial stability necessary for a successful and fulfilled life.
